Climate and Nature Champion

Cllr Stewart Manley, Chair of the Biodiversity and Environment Committee, is Brackley Town Council’s NCALC Climate and Nature (CAN) Champion, acting as the council’s advocate for sustainability, biodiversity, and climate resilience. Learn more via the link below:

Nature Recovery Strategy

The Council is taking part in the public consultation for the West Northamptonshire Local Nature Recovery Strategy (LNRS), which guides local action to protect and restore habitats. More information is available below:

Wildlife Trust

Brackley Town Council also works with the Wildlife Trust for Bedfordshire, Cambridgeshire, and Northamptonshire (WTBCN), supporting projects that protect and restore wildlife and wild places. Find out more on their website:

Climate Action West northants

Climate Action – West Northamptonshire (CA-WN) is a volunteer-run residents’ group working to reduce greenhouse gas emissions, enhance biodiversity, and strengthen community resilience to the impacts of climate change. Learn more on the CA-WN website:
